A lighter is a device used for lighting fire, which is said to be flammable. There are rules that the TSA has made for every passenger must abide by when bringing items on the plane. However, can you bring a lighter on the plane? This article will tell you whether you can bring a lighter on the plane.
You are only allowed to bring some specific type of lighter on the plane. According to the TSA, you can only bring a cigarette lighter on the plane, which is disposable or a zippo lighter. It can also have fuel in them if it is in your carry-on. You are only allowed to carry this type of lighter with fuel only in your carry-on bag. When you are taking this type of lighter in checked luggage, there should be no fuel in your lighter.
TSA recommends you empty your lighter before taking it in your checked luggage to prevent fire hazards in the cargo hold. You can only bring your disposable or zippo lighter with fuel to your checked bag if you adhere to the Department of Transportation exemption, which allows up to two fueled lighters if properly enclosed in a DOT-approved case.

How many lighters can you bring on a plane?
You can only take one cigarette lighter in your carry-on to the plane. Lighters fluids are also allowed in checked luggage, but they should be in DOT-approved cases, and the maximum you can put there are two lighters.
You can bring two lighters per person in checked luggage, but only one is allowed in your carry-on bag. That means you can only bring three lighters on a plane: one in your carry-on and two in your checked luggage. If you want to bring lighter than the maximum amount given by the FAA, then make sure they are empty before boarding the plane.

Can you bring a lighter on a plane?
TSA allows you to bring a lighter on the plane if it is a disposable or zippo lighter. You can take this lighter with fuel only in your carry-on luggage. You should know that there are different rules for taking a lighter in your carry-on and checked baggage. You cannot take your lighter out on the plane; it should be in your bag or pocket.
You are not allowed to take lighter fluid in your checked luggage to prevent fire hard in the cargo hold. If you take this stated lighter in your checked baggage, the lighter must be empty. You can only bring your disposable or zippo lighter with fuel to your checked bag if you adhere to the Department of Transportation exemption, which allows up to two fueled lighters if properly enclosed in a DOT-approved case.
In addition, some types of lighter are not allowed on the plane, both in carry-on or checked luggage. These types of lighter are torch lighters, gun lighters, arc lighters, electronic lighters, plasma lighters, and e-lighters.
Can you bring butane lighter on the plane?
Butane torch lighter are not allowed on the plane, both in carry-on and checked luggage. The only two types of lighter allowed on the plane are disposable and zippo lighter. Any other types of lighter apart from these two are not allowed on the plane.
